Ten Times when Chiranjeevi and Balakrishna Films had a Clash at the Box Office

Sankranthi festival is not only a big festival for the Telugu public but also for the film industry. During this festival season, every year we witness a minimum of three films coming to the theatres but the real hype is being created when the clash of titans happens at the ticket windows. One such in Tollywood is between Chiranjeevi and Balakrishna will always be a special and most awaited one. Now, we bring you the list of when Chiranjeevi and Balakrishna films had a clash at the box office.

  • 1985

For the first time, both films of Chiranjeevi and Balakrishna had a clash at the box office in 1985. NBK’s Aatmabalam and Chiranjeevi’s Chattamtho Poratam had a clash at the box office in this year. Though both films are flops at the ticket windows, comparatively Chattamtho Poratam had a decent run.

  • 1987

This year Chiranjeevi’s Donga Mogudu and Balakrishna’s Bhargava Ramudu had a clash during the Sankranthi season. While Bhargava Ramudu ended up as a flop, Donga Mogudu was a blockbuster success.

  • 1988

In 1988, Balakrishna’s Inspector Pratap and Chiranjeevi’s Manchi Donga had a clash during the Sankranthi season and both ended up as hit films.

  • 1997

In this year, Balakrishna’s Peddannayya and Chiranjeevi’s Hitler had a clash at the ticket windows and both the films ended as good hits at the box office.

  • 1999

In 1999, Balakrishna’s Samara Simha Reddy and Chiranjeevi’s Sneham Kosam had a box-office clash. While Samara Simha Reddy ended up as an industry hit, Sneham Kosam failed miserably at the ticket windows.

  • 2000

In the year 2000, Megastar Chiranjeevi’s Annayya and Balakrishna’s Vamsoddharakudu had a theatrical release. While Annayya ended up as a hit, Vamsoddharakudu was a flop.

  • 2001

In the year 2001, Balakrishna’s Narasimha Naidu and Chiranjeevi’s Mrugaraju had a theatrical clash. While Mrugaraju ended up as a disaster, Narasimha Naidu ended up as an industry hit.

  • 2004

During this year’s Sankranthi season, Balakrishna’s Lakshmi Nara Simha and Chiranjeevi’s Anji had a theatrical clash. In the clash, Balakrishna scored a super hit with LNS.

  • 2017

During Sankranthi 2017, Chiranjeevi’s Khaidi No. 150 and Balakrishna’s Gautamiputra Satakarni had a clash. While Khaidi No.150 ended up as a blockbuster, Gautamiputra Satakarni also was a good hit.

  • 2023

This year during the Sankranthi season, Balakrishna and Chiranjeevi are locking horns for the tenth time with Veera Simha Reddy and Waltair Veerayya respectively. Have to wait and see which of these crazy films will end up as a super hit at the box office.
